Kelsey Sucena, assistant professor of photography, attends International Trans* Studies Conference

Kelsey Sucena, assistant professor of photography in Alfred University’s School of Art & Design, attended the second annual International Trans* Studies Conference, held Sept. 4-7 in Evanston, IL.


Sucena said her attendance at the conference “helped bring depth to her research into trans culture and theory at a crucial moment in their (art) practice.” Sucena added she “brought back to Alfred deeper engagement in the field of trans* studies, new connections on and off campus, and a renewed vigor for Alfred’s own trans* community.”

The conference, organized by the International Transgender Studies Association (ITSA) brought together scholars from around the globe, across the arts, humanities, social sciences, and STEM, all of whom are committed to research on transgender and gender-minority issues.
